The question shouldn't be "Can real money be made" rather "Can he get near enough to breaking even" by producing oldskool.
Most dj's don't make much from tune releases, there often lucky to break even. Most money for dj's comes when they get payed to play at events. but of course if they didn't produce there tunes then they wouldn't be offered to play out....so it's an evil little circle of events really!

basically vibes has stuck with playing sets that are mainly records premillinium, and for this a lot of production companies don't/won't book him because they believe more in forward movement of the scene versus being stuck in the 90's...hence why you don't see him on many line ups...
